You might be able to pull this off by removing the rc.d from install.sh, I wouldn't trust me to make the call but with that in mind I think it would be safe modification.
What wouldn't be safe is running an installer desinged around another distro in Mepis. You have no idea what else it depends on that isn't there, or worse it may change a system setting from a perfectly fine value in (Red Hat?) to another value perfectly fine value in Red Hat, but a value that makes Mepis unbootable.
